Output 5b701046870a8c18faa86f1dcc1b373f245d40143dfeb079e940baa35f4853aa:1

value
890721209
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b74357f48fc11f518a351d1a73c60d945057cadc OP_EQUAL
address
3JQ2FmAt129ZWJbLY9rz1jXii6JpbAtHiL
transaction
5b701046870a8c18faa86f1dcc1b373f245d40143dfeb079e940baa35f4853aa
confirmations
229963
spent
true